Fish: 15. Baked Salmon

Clean, and cut the fish into slices ; put it in a dish, and make the following sauce: Melt an ounce of butter, kneaded in flour, in a pint and half of gravy, with two glasses of port wine, two tablespoonfuls of catsup, two anchovies, and a little cayenne. When the anchovies are dissolved, strain and pour the sauce over the fish, tie a sheet of buttered paper over the dish, and bake in an oven. Trout also answer well dressed in this way.
